Вопрос по коду в posting_smilies.tpl

Есть любые вопросы, связанные со стилями/темами для phpBB 2.0.x? Задайте их здесь!
Правила форума
Если на ваш вопрос есть ответы по ниже следующим ссылкам, ваш пост удаляется без объяснения причин!!!
А вы рискуете получить предупреждение или бан (в зависимости от настроения модератора).


Местная Конституция | Шаблон запроса | Документация (phpBB3) | FAQ-2 (phpbb2) | FAQ-3 (phpbb3) | Как задавать вопросы | Как устанавливать моды

Вопрос по коду в posting_smilies.tpl

Сообщение Dealer 17.03.2006 15:57

Вопрос к гуру phpBB. Версия форума 2.0.19.

В темплейте posting_body.tpl есть кусок кода, который отвечает за открытие всплывающего окна дополнительных смайлов:

Код: Выделить всё
            <!-- BEGIN switch_smilies_extra -->
            <tr align="center">
              <td colspan="{S_SMILIES_COLSPAN}"><span  class="nav"><a href="{U_MORE_SMILIES}" onclick="window.open('{U_MORE_SMILIES}', '_phpbbsmilies', 'HEIGHT=300,resizable=yes,scrollbars=yes,WIDTH=250');return false;" target="_phpbbsmilies" class="nav">{L_MORE_SMILIES}</a></span></td>
            </tr>
            <!-- END switch_smilies_extra -->

С этим всё понятно... Но в темплейте posting_smilies.tpl, который, как я понимаю, и формирует это самое окно, содержится точно такой же кусок кода с минимальными (несущественными) отличиями:

Код: Выделить всё
               <!-- BEGIN switch_smilies_extra -->
               <tr align="center">
                  <td colspan="{S_SMILIES_COLSPAN}"><span  class="nav"><a href="{U_MORE_SMILIES}" onclick="open_window('{U_MORE_SMILIES}', 250, 300);return false" target="_smilies" class="nav">{L_MORE_SMILIES}</a></td>
               </tr>
               <!-- END switch_smilies_extra -->

Подскажите, я что-то не могу понять, для чего он там? Что должно открываться из уже открытого окна дополнительных смайлов? Может, есть какие дополнительные возможности у форума и как их активировать (ссылки во всплывающем окне нет)... Или это просто осколок кода, который "забыли" убрать?

Спасибо!
Аватара пользователя
Dealer
phpBB 1.2.0
 
Сообщения: 13
Зарегистрирован: 06.03.2006 19:28


Сообщение Xpert 17.03.2006 16:54

Имхо, это как раз тот случай, когда код продублировали, а ненужное не вырезали, вот и все... Удалять или нет - дело вкуса.
Эксперт - это человек, который избегает мелких ошибок на пути к грандиозному провалу.
Любая более-менее сложная задача имеет несколько простых, изящных, лёгких для понимания неправильных решений
Аватара пользователя
Xpert
phpBB Guru
 
Сообщения: 5636
Зарегистрирован: 13.03.2004 21:27
Откуда: msk.ru

Сообщение Dealer 17.03.2006 21:37

Xpert, спасибо! Я его действительно удалил...

Вопрос задавал, засомневавшись, что target разные значения присвоены...
Думал, возможно есть/планировалось сделать что-то типа разделения
окон смайлов по категориям (когда их много становится)...
Аватара пользователя
Dealer
phpBB 1.2.0
 
Сообщения: 13
Зарегистрирован: 06.03.2006 19:28



Вернуться в Стили для phpBB 2.0.x

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ей и гости: 0

cron